Facilities Ticket — Cleaning Crew Access, Brindle Annex

For new starters handling evening lock-up: the Sorano Cleaning crew arrives nightly at 21:30 via the annex side door. Check their rota sheet, note arrival in the log, and ensure the storeroom is relocked afterward. To let them through the side door, enter the access code below.

badge for yaweg-hafog: bdg-GX-6

## Nightly backfill scheduler for Project Anvilgate

Quick one for the sync: this adds a cron-driven scheduler that queues backfill jobs for the Harrowfield datasets overnight, with per-dataset concurrency caps so we stop starving the morning ETL. Retries are jittered now, which should kill the thundering-herd pattern we saw last week. The knobs we're shipping with are listed below.

constants for hahof-bajep:
THRESHOLDS = {
    "sorwyn": 797,
    "jorath": 933,
    "pramir": 998,
    "wenath": 950,
    "silok": 489,
    "prawyn": 572,
    "praiel": 821,
}

Minutes – Management Meeting, Tuesday session. Attendees: department heads, chaired by M. Varrow. The pilot with retail chain Bexley & Frost is on track: twelve stores live, checkout integration stable, returns data flowing into Harbourline analytics. Staff training in the Northgate region completes next week. Bexley & Frost have requested a mid-pilot review before committing to a second tranche of stores. Budget remains within the approved envelope. Please brief your teams accordingly. The commercial terms under negotiation are set out below.

internal memo for kawip-hadug: Headcount on the Wenwyn team goes from 7 to 140 by the end of January. Gross margin on Wenwyn came in at 20 percent against a plan of 15 percent.